It looks like we are getting the equivalent of a live link to Blender according to an email I just received from Reallusion. And no....RL should not following DAZ down that retarded NFT path. Daz ( owned by Tafi) is completely realigning their business model over to an NFT CRYPTO hub. The Metahumans crushed Daz's last hope of becoming a major provider of realistic Characters for the gaming market so it's understandable that they are seeking new market in NFT/ Crypto. They have not even updated thier official bridge to work with Blender 3. Reallusion is Wise to further develop its Blender pipeline tools being that Blender is free.
